Would you prefer sitting on Santa's lap or mine with your legs open?
2:10
1080p
732 Views

Advertisement
emoji
emoji
161
emoji
1061
emoji
1177
emoji
1226
emoji
325
Share
Report this video as:

Suggested for you Ad

Advertisement